#274811 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#274811 is composed of 15.3% red, 28.2%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 17.5%. #274811 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e9022 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#274811 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#274811 has RGB values of R:39, G:72,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 2574353.

Shades and Tints of #274811
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050902 is the darkest color, while #fafd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#274811
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2d2c is the less saturated color, while #245603 is the most saturated one.
